2.2 <strong>CA</strong>IJNET Macro2.2 <strong>CA</strong>IJNET Macro2.2.1 OptionsIf you are using NJE, use the <strong>CA</strong>IJNET macro to describe your network Code aseparate macro <strong>for</strong> each node in the network. Then assemble and link toproduce a phase named <strong>CA</strong>IJNET. A sample job can be found in member<strong>CA</strong>IJNET of the Z sublibrary of the Source Statement Library. For details onupdating these options, see the Note at the end of this topic.APPLID=xxxxxxxxGive the 1-8 character application ID <strong>for</strong> this node. It must match the APPLIDdefined to VTAM. (See the topic Defining VTAM APPLID <strong>for</strong> <strong>Unicenter</strong><strong>CA</strong>-<strong>Scheduler</strong> in the <strong>Unicenter</strong> <strong>CA</strong>-<strong>Scheduler</strong> Installation Guide.)NNAME=xxxxxxxxGive the name of this node as defined to POWER in PNODE macro. This isrequired.NTYPE=JES2|JES3|POWERUse this only if this node runs under a different operating system than thelocal node. Specify the correct JES system (JES2 or JES3) <strong>for</strong> MVS or POWER<strong>for</strong> <strong>VSE</strong>.JESREL=xxxThis option is required if the 'NTYPE' option is coded with an MVS parameter.Give the JES version <strong>for</strong> this node: SP2, 134, 215, 220, 221, 311. If you have anyother JES version, contact Computer Associates.NSYSID=sysidGive the SYSID. This is required. If there are two or more CPUs, code aseparate macro <strong>for</strong> each.VTAMLIM=limitGive a numeric value in kilobytes that will be used as a threshold limit to theamount of private storage used <strong>for</strong> communication between this node and thelocal node. Increase this value if you receive message <strong>CA</strong>CM079E. Thedefault is 26. The DISPLAY NETWORK command can be used to show theamount of storage used <strong>for</strong> communication at any one time.2-22 <strong>Unicenter</strong> <strong>CA</strong>-<strong>Scheduler</strong> <strong>Systems</strong> Programmer Guide
